The Core of the Tour: Exploring London at Your Own Pace

What makes this pass attractive is primarily its flexibility. For a price of approximately $75.44, you unlock unlimited use of double-decker buses on two routes, giving you the freedom to hop off at the sights that catch your eye. It’s a straightforward way to see London without rushing or stressing about tickets at each stop.

The Landmarks Tour is a solid start, covering essential sights like Big Ben, Westminster Abbey, Trafalgar Square, and the Tower of London. We loved how this route allows you to explore at your own pace, with a suggested duration of 2 hours 30 minutes but ample time to linger or move along as you please. The stops are well-placed for iconic photography and quick sightseeing, making it easy to customize your day.

The Park and Palace Tour takes you through the lush surroundings of Hyde Park and Kensington Palace Gardens. It’s a quieter side of the city, perfect for those who prefer a break from the busy streets. Key stops include Notting Hill, Marble Arch, and Paddington Station, all with free entry and plenty of photo opportunities. Reviewers highlighted the ease of finding posted stops and the convenience of using the buses to access these areas.

The Night Tour: Seeing London Under Lights

One of the standout features of this pass is the London Lights Night Tour at 7:00 or 7:30 PM, with a live guide. This evening journey showcases London’s beauty as landmarks are illuminated — think London Eye, Big Ben, Tower Bridge, and Piccadilly Circus. The guide, whose name isn’t specified but apparently knowledgeable, shares stories that bring the city’s history to life.

Travelers who went on this tour loved the stunning views and the lively atmosphere. The night experience is especially recommended for those who want a romantic or atmospheric perspective of London, or simply a memorable way to end a day. Keep in mind that the tour lasts about 1 hour 30 minutes, so plan accordingly for your evening.

Unique Experiences: Thames Cruise and Themed Walks

A nice addition is the Thames River Cruise, which offers a relaxed way to see the city from the water. Passing landmarks like Tower of London, Tower Bridge, and The Shard, the cruise provides a panoramic view you can’t get from the streets. The live commentary sheds light on the history behind these sights, making it more engaging than just a boat ride.

The Royal Park & Palace Walk is another highlight. Starting at Trafalgar Square, it takes you through St. James’s Park, Buckingham Palace (you’ll see the front), and Wellington Barracks. This guided walk reveals stories behind the royal residences and their surroundings, appealing to history buffs or those wanting a grounded, leisurely walk. Reviewers appreciated the helpful guides and the chance to explore royal London at a relaxed pace.

Similarly, the Rock ’n’ Roll Soho Walk uncovers London’s vibrant music history, visiting legendary venues like the Marquis Club and Bricklayers Arms. Music fans loved this behind-the-scenes look at London’s contribution to the global rock scene, with the guide sharing anecdotal stories that make the history come alive.

The Dark Side: Jack the Ripper Walk

For those intrigued by London’s darker tales, the Jack the Ripper Walk is a chilling journey through Whitechapel’s streets, focusing on the killer’s known sites and the stories that captivated Victorian London. The roughly 1 hour 50-minute walk covers spots like Goulston Street and Ten Bells Pub, where Ripper’s victims and evidence still lurk in the imagination. Reviewers noted the intriguing storytelling, although this walk is best suited for mature audiences due to its eerie subject matter.

Practicalities and What to Expect

The tour’s unlimited hop-on hop-off option is a key advantage, allowing you to explore at your pace without being tied to strict schedules, though there are fixed times for some walks and the night tour. The buses are semi-open double-deckers, offering great photo opportunities and views of the city’s architecture.

Most reviewers found the bus drivers helpful, especially when trying to download tickets or coordinate schedules. One mentioned, “The drivers were very helpful from the very beginning,” highlighting good customer service. However, a few noted that bus schedules can be unpredictable, with occasional no-shows, so it’s wise to have some flexibility and plan ahead.

The inclusions like free earphones for commentary (available in 14 languages), and the ability to use the pass within 12 months of purchase, add value. The pass is suitable for almost all travelers, with a few restrictions—children must be accompanied, and you’ll want to check if attraction entry fees apply separately.
